Keith Hernandez - RotoBaller

65958 articles

Keith is a sports fanatic through and through. He has been immersed in the sports world as far back as he can remember, and played competitive baseball in high school and college (University of California -- San Diego) as a four-year captain. He also dabbled semi-professionally overseas for a short time before becoming obsessed with fantasy sports, starting in 2006. He's been writing and editing fantasy content ever since, with stops at KFFL and USA TODAY Sports. He has played alongside some of the brightest fantasy minds in the industry, including LABR (League of Alternate Baseball Reality).
